Prometheus is an open-source systems monitoring and alerting toolkit. Does SCOM have the ability to monitor containers and container management systems (eg. Docker )? Docker stats provides an overview of some metrics we need to collect to ensure the basic monitoring function of Docker containers. This API gives us an access to CPU usage, memory, networking information and disk utilization for a running Docker container.
It is about displaying a live stream of a container(s) resource usage statistics. Docker Enterprise is the easiest and fastest way to use containers and Kubernetes at scale and delivers the fastest time to production for modern applications, securely running them from hybrid cloud to the edge.
Over 7enterprise organizations use Docker Enterprise for everything from modernizing applications to microservices and data science. When it comes to Docker container monitoring , using a dedicated tool provides a solution that you can reuse across all of your applications instead of building something specific for each. Monitoring is the first step towards optimizing and improving performance.
You also gain a partner dedicated to enhancing Docker container monitoring , which is invaluable for proactive issue detection, as well as in times of crisis. Alerts are set on disk usage, memory usage and load usage to warn when the metric are critics. To add docker monitoring to your servers click the Roles tab and then select All Servers.
Once you have the details view up select Install Plugin to add the plugin to your hosts. Docker is a container allowing developers to package an application with all of its dependencies without the need for an operating system. Monitoring Docker containers and all its related metrics will help reduce occurance of bottlenecks, thereby optimizing performance.
Docker already took care of it and provided its own real-time monitoring tool which reports resource utilization by each container in real time. If you still don’t have Docker on your system, read here how to install Docker in Linux and basic Docker management commands. It covers networks, servers, and applications.
It will also monitor your Docker container traffic. A sensor monitors one type of activity, such as CPU usage on a server, or data throughput on a network. PRTG is composed of services that are called sensors.
If you want to monitor the state of your cluster in you own monitoring system , you can use the following snippets as a base to create your probes. Prerequisites You need a running UCP 2. Part discusses the novel challenge of monitoring containers instead of hosts, part covers the nuts and bolts of collecting Docker resource metrics, and part describes how the largest TV and radio outlet in the U. Getting started with Docker Containers monitoring using Microsoft OMS. Anyway lets stick to OMS and Docker Container monitoring , which now is a preview feature as.
A monitoring solution for Docker hosts, containers and containerized services. I’ve been looking for an open source self-hosted monitoring solution that can provide metrics storage, visualization and alerting for physical servers, virtual machines, containers and services that are running inside containers. SignalFx is an infrastructure monitor that can monitor Docker.
SignalFx allows you to monitor hosts , containers , and applications from a single pane of glass. Docker Monitoring and Performance Management Docker is an open source software container management system. A major advantage of using this is that docker containers on a single machine share the same operating system kernel, which helps in boosting performance and saving a lot of memory.
Monitoring docker containers is a challenge as they are isolated and the applications are dynamically allocated.
For Docker containers, SignalFX will monitor metrics using the stats API to report on CPU, memory, and disk. A dashboard will first provide you with an aggregate view of metrics across all containers and let you drill down into each docker host and container to see where performance issues lie. We’ll use Docker, for the quick deployment our monitoring system, also it’ll gives us a freedom to use any software with dependency free and keep our system clean after. Topical, You can look at Docker from this side too, as a cross-platform package system. Most of the Docker collection programs run at the host versus containers.
On a large system , you could run hundreds of containers, which means hundreds of snmpd processes. Monitor all Docker containers running image web in region us-west-across all availability zones that use more than 1. With queryable tags you’ll have a powerful system that makes monitoring your highly dynamic, container-based architecture straightforward and effective. UnRaid system and docker monitoring.
Monitor both the Docker environment and apps that run inside them.
No comments:
Post a Comment
Note: Only a member of this blog may post a comment.